 William Bell Biography
One of the pioneers of the Southern school of '60s soul, William Bell is most famous for the classic "You Don't Miss Your Water," a song that remains a landmark in the development of country R&B. In a bizarre turn of events, new wave pinup boy Billy Idol had a big hit with Bell's "To Be a Lover" in 1986.
